Woo hoo! I was able to get an ARC of Samantha Kane's next novel in the Birmingham Rebels series from NetGalley for an honest review. No problem, there!  I have been anxiously awaiting this story.  

I enjoy how Samantha lets you get to know the characters and allows you to be invested in them by the time they have sex and once they do, whew boy!  SMOKING. HOT.  We got a glimpse of Ty in the first book (see my review here) and I was looking forward to his story.  Like the other book we have M/F/M and M/M scenes but Samantha Kane writes in such a way that you can feel the characters' passion and love for one another. It's sweet and loving.  And the characters are discovering what they want and need and Kane takes you on their journey in such a way that you don't want the book to be over.   

Brian and Ty have a history and are brought together again due to football.  Randi and Ty are new to seeing each other but she sees the love simmering between the friends. She's attracted to both men and decides she wants in on that.  The chemistry and feelings involved are more than any of them expected and they have to decide what it is they truly want.  

I enjoyed the team camaraderie and bantering they do.  They are learning how to be a good, solid team; a family.  They are the misfits no one wants, but the Rebels are serious NFL players and they want to show the world what they've got! Some of them also have issues that need to be worked out and Kane shows us their world, as much as the trio.  This story is HOT HOT HOT! and very enjoyable.  And based on her descriptions, I want to attend a Rebels game! lol








Samantha Kane’s Birmingham Rebels series—perfect for fans of Shayla Black and Lexi Blake—proves that three’s never a crowd . . . at least not for the hard-bodied football all-stars who give teamwork a sexy twist.

Quarterback Tyler Oakes plays hard and parties even harder. That reckless lifestyle nearly derailed his career, and now the Birmingham Rebels are Ty’s last shot at football immortality. But staying out of trouble can take its toll—especially for a man with a taste for girls and guys. Because curvy, gorgeous Randi McInish is just the kind of trouble he’d like to get into.

A tough-as-nails undercover cop, Randi meets her match in Ty. After they get wrapped up together in a drug bust and a high-speed car chase, Randi’s eager to take the notorious bad boy for another wild ride. Turns out Ty already has something in mind. When he introduces her to the Rebels’ sexy new quarterback coach, things start heating up a little too fast for Randi.

Brian Mason coached Ty in college, and boy do they have history together. With Brian taking control on the field and in the bedroom, they were an unstoppable team. But Brian, blindsided by love, ran from his feelings for Ty. He won’t let Randi make the same mistake. Both men agree they need more than each other. They want a woman they can share. And when they make a pleasure play for Randi, all three are sure to score.
